 The government has set out its plans for radically changing the way the NHS is organised, with a wholesale shake-up of the way services are commissioned, healthcare providers operate, outcomes are measured, and patients and the public involved.

NICE is at the heart of these changes, with a central role for quality standards, which will inform the commissioning of all NHS care, payment and inspection systems.
Now in its 11th year, the NICE Annual Conference brings together health and social care experts, policy makers and industry representatives shaping healthcare provision today. 2011's conference will provide you with key updates on what the health bill means and how these changes will work in practice. The conference will focus on the practical, to support you to ensure you are offering the highest quality care and value for money.
